Who is Symone Sanders?
Before becoming a familiar face in primetime television, Symone Sanders-Townsend built a strong reputation in the high-pressure world of presidential campaigns, where her sharp strategy, confident political voice, and deep understanding of politics helped her rise quickly.
As an American political strategist, author, television host, and trusted spokesperson, she first gained national attention as national press secretary for Bernie Sanders during the 2016 presidential bid. Her growing career later led her to the Biden-Harris administration, where she worked as Senior Advisor and Chief Spokesperson to Vice President Kamala Harris.
Today, she co-hosts The Weeknight on MS NOW with Alicia Menendez and Michael Steele, a powerful platform that further cements her standing as a leading political media voice in the country. From Omaha Roots to Political Media Powerhouse
Long before becoming known across the political world and media, Symone Sanders-Townsend was a bold young child growing up far from the big city lights of New York and D.C.. She was born and raised in Omaha, Nebraska, where her parents encouraged her to believe that her ideas mattered.
Her confidence with a microphone and natural communication skills became clear early in her life, especially when she would talk, share, and lead discussions in her local community. While studying business and leadership at Creighton University, she realized she had a natural strength in communication, a skill that later became the foundation of her political career. After she finished school, she did not wait for luck to change her future.
Instead, she started working closely with the Mayor of Omaha, handling news, public relations, and difficult moments with reporters asking tough questions. A Historic Rise in National Campaign Politics
In 2016, the whole country started noticing Symone when she became Bernie Sanders National Press Secretary at just 25 years old, working for a presidential candidate on TV every day. She stood next to her boss, sharing plans with millions of people in a clear style full of power during a tough national campaign.

From White House to Primetime Television Success
After leaving the White House, Symone Sanders made a major shift to MSNBC, where she finally got her own show called Symone, also streaming on Peacock streaming service during weekends. The show stood out because it mixed culture, fashion, and real-life issues, not just politics, which helped her connect with a wider modern audience.
In 2025, the network MS NOW was rebranded, and she was placed in a strong primetime slot at 7 PM with her show The Weeknight, which quickly became a must-watch program focused on truth and real explanation of news.
